What [OpenMeetings.org] is: if anybody has seen or heard of MetaVid.org, they take C-SPAN footage, they strip out the C-SPAN logo and they make the entire video text–searchable according to at least government–provided sources. We're a bit different in that the transcripts don't yet exist, but that's why there's a wiki that enables that.
